May 7, 2011 is going to be an eventful day in Rome, Georgia. Enjoy taking a walk down Broad Street to see a wonderful variety of art work that will be on display from 10 AM to 5 PM as part of Art Walk.
Celebrate International Museum Day by visiting Oak Hill and Martha Berry Museum. Admission is FREE from 10 AM to 5 PM. See demonstrations on how to use a weaving loom and spinning wheel as well as the “Rich Tapestry” exhibit that shares the history of handicrafts at Berry College.
Learn about the Spirits of the Civil War from 1 PM to 2:30 PM at the Rome/Floyd County Visitor’s Center. Take a tour of downtown Rome on the Toonerville Trolley to learn about the major Civil War sites in the area. The tour is FREE but tickets are required. Call 706-295-5576 for tickets.
